Role Description - Web and Digital Content Designer
Reporting to: Hannah Ippolito
Place of Work: SquareKicker Office - 2/10 Tokomaru Place, Stoke
The Web and Digital Content Designer will create visually compelling Squarespace websites and digital content that demonstrate what is possible with SquareKicker. Working alongside our Written Content Producer and Video Producer across marketing, product launches and education, they will turn ideas into polished visual concepts that communicate SquareKicker’s brand values and speak to the needs, workflows and creative ambitions of professional Squarespace designers.
With no client brief or handoff to work around, this role offers the freedom to channel creative energy into exploring ideas, experimenting with new approaches and pushing the boundaries of our products to inspire users with what is possible. This is a hands-on role for someone creative who can take ownership of projects and turn ambitious ideas into engaging, high-quality work.
You will bring strong design judgement, creative curiosity and the ability to turn ideas into polished, engaging work that reflects both SquareKicker’s brand and the perspective of our users. Experience designing in Squarespace would be a significant advantage, but it is not essential. What matters most is a strong understanding of digital design, thoughtful creative decision-making and an enthusiasm for learning what is possible with new tools.
This is an office-based role in Nelson, approximately 30 hours per week. Our working days are Tuesday to Friday, with flexibility around how those hours are structured and hours negotiable for the right candidate.

Responsibilities
Design and build visually compelling Squarespace website and page examples for tutorials, YouTube content, product demonstrations and campaigns that demonstrate what is creatively possible with Squarespace and SquareKicker.
Create high-quality visual assets for SquareKicker’s website, marketing campaigns, product launches and educational content.
Translate product, marketing and educational ideas into clear, engaging visual concepts.
Take ownership of assigned design projects from initial brief through to final delivery.
Maintain reusable design templates, resources and asset libraries to support efficient and consistent production.
Contribute ideas and creative thinking during project discussions.
Work collaboratively with the Creative team and across the wider company as required.
Work within SquareKicker’s established brand direction to maintain a consistent standard across all visual output.
Stay current with modern design tools and emerging technologies and adapt your workflow as the design landscape evolves.
